Yuen Ping Wu passed away the morning of January 9, 2022 at home, just days short of her 97th birthday. She was predeceased by her husband, Fook Shing Ho. She is survived by her daughter, Wai Ying "Carol" Shek (Tak Chun), and her grandchildren Anthony Shek, Andorra Fields (Michael), Angela Heard (Timothy), and Anita Shek (Ian Thomas).

Yuen Ping was born in 1926 in Hong Kong and moved to the United States with her husband in 1980 to be with her daughter for the birth of her 4th grandchild. She was a loving wife, sister, mother, grandmother, caretaker, and friend. She loved to cook, laugh, and share dim sum and dinners with family and friends. She was the keeper of recipes and evolved them into precious family traditions. She was our family's secret recipe. She cared greatly for her family, her friends, and God.
